The Milwaukee Bucks visit Amway Center to take on the Orlando Magic on Tuesday. Tipoff is scheduled for 7:00pm EST in Orlando.
The Bucks are betting favorites in this NBA matchup, with the spread sitting at -2.5 (-105).
The Bucks vs Magic Over/Under is 227.5 total points for the game.
So far this NBA season, the Bucks are 35-25 against the spread, while the Magic are 35-28 against the spread.

Injury Report: Magic vs. Bucks – Tuesday‘s Game, Mar. 7
- Jonathan Isaac (Magic): Jonathan Isaac underwent surgery to repair a torn left adductor, the Magic announced he will miss the rest of the regular-season. (Per. Woj)
- Admiral Schofield (Magic): Schofield is OUT for Tuesday’s (Mar 7) game against Milwaukee.
- Wendell Carter Jr. (Magic): Carter Jr. is questionable for Tuesday’s (Mar 7) game against Milwaukee.
- Gary Harris (Magic): Harris is questionable for Tuesday’s (Mar 7) game against Milwaukee.
- Jrue Holiday (Bucks): Holiday is questionable for Tuesday’s (Mar 7) game against Orlando.
- Goran Dragic (Bucks): Dragic is OUT for Tuesday’s (Mar 7) game against Orlando.
- Giannis Antetokounmpo (Bucks): Antetokounmpo is probable for Tuesday’s (Mar 7) game against Orlando.
- Wesley Matthews (Bucks): Matthews hasn’t played since Feb. 16 against Chicago and remains without a timetable to return.
Milwaukee Bucks Offensive Stats & Trends
The Bucks have averaged 8.4 second chance points per game (522 points/62 games) in the first half this season — tied for best among NBA teams; League Avg: 6.7
The Bucks have averaged 43.4 points in the paint per game (1,302 points/30 games) on the road this season — 2nd l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 49.7
The Bucks shot 39% from three (1,038/2,669) in the 2020-21 season — tied for 4th best among NBA teams; League Avg: 37%
The Bucks have averaged 117.0 points per game (25,268 points/216 games) since the start of the 2020-21 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 112.1
Orlando Magic Offensive Stats & Trends
The Magic are shooting 43% (4,165/9,572) in the first half since the start of the 2020-21 season — l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 47%
The Magic have averaged 107.1 points per game (15,208 points/142 games) since the start of the 2021-22 season — l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 112.2
The Magic have averaged 52.0 points per game (11,135 points/214 games) in the first half since the start of the 2020-21 season — l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 56.5
The Magic have averaged 1.16 points per shot (11,135 points/9,572 shots) in the first half since the start of the 2020-21 season — l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 1.26
Milwaukee Bucks Defensive Stats & Trends
The Bucks have averaged 37.3 defensive rebounds per game (8,056 rebounds/216 games) since the start of the 2020-21 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 33.9
The Bucks have averaged 37.0 defensive rebounds per game (5,332 rebounds/144 games) since the start of the 2021-22 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 33.6
The Bucks have averaged 37.8 defensive rebounds per game (2,342 rebounds/62 games) this season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 33.0
The Bucks have averaged 6.5 steals per game (405 steals/62 games) this season — tied for 5th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 7.3
Orlando Magic Defensive Stats & Trends
The Magic have averaged 4.5 blocks per game (962 blocks/214 games) since the start of the 2020-21 season — 10th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 4.8
The Magic have averaged 34.3 defensive rebounds per game (4,868 rebounds/142 games) since the start of the 2021-22 season — tied for 9th best among NBA teams; League Avg: 33.7
The Magic have averaged 6.9 steals per game (973 steals/142 games) since the start of the 2021-22 season — tied for 5th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 7.5
The Magic have averaged 6.9 steals per game (1,469 steals/214 games) since the start of the 2020-21 season — tied for 5th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 7.5
